Augusto Fernandez : Now Pedro Acosta is the Best Rider at the KTM Factory

RiderTua.com – When his GasGas Tech3 teammate Pedro Acosta celebrated the podium (finishing 2nd) at COTA, Augusto Fernandez was only able to finish 14th with a difference of 26 seconds. Thanks to finishing 3rd at Portimao and 3rd at COTA, the 19 year old rookie is now in 4th place in the standings and is the best KTM (Pierer Group) rider in the 2024 MotoGP World Championship.

The question is, has Acosta been given priority at Pierer Group regarding new development parts? Fernandez revealed that now Acosta is the best rider at the KTM factory. Pedro Acosta was able to get the best parts from the factory… He was on the podium, the next KTM rider was 9th in Austin. He is also in the best position in the standings. So he deserves to be the first rider to receive the newest parts.”

Pedro Acosta’s extraordinary performance became a reference and a rallying cry for his team. Augusto Fernandez added that they have to understand why he can race so fast. So, they need to take a closer look at what was done in Jerez and copy a few things. All riders did a lot of laps at Jerez. As Fernandez said, Jerez is a good track for this. A test there would also be good for them. It won’t happen in a day, but we’ll see if they can take a step forward.

Regarding Acosta’s data, Fernandez revealed, “Actually there is nothing special, there are several places, for example in fast corners. He has high confidence in the front of the bike, including the brakes. In corners, the lean angle is high. He lets the bike slide, like in Turn 2 at Austin.”

“We have to study the data very intensively. Pedro also uses his body a lot. We also have all the data, so let’s analyze it and continue working on it. We have to take steps at Jerez,” stressed the Moto2 Champion for the 2022 season.

What’s also interesting is PA#31’s statement that it doesn’t go too deep into engine tuning. Acosta emphasized that he was also in Texas with the same basic coordination as the first test in Valencia almost 6 months ago. Whether it was due to the subtlety of the RC16’s set-up or simply Acosta’s mistake, all riders can learn from Acosta’s relaxed attitude.
